About DSCIData Security Council of India (DSCI) is a premier industry body on data protection in India,

setup by NASSCOM®, committed to making the cyberspace safe, secure and trusted by

establishing best practices, standards and initiatives in cyber security and privacy.

DSCI brings together national governments and their agencies, industry sectors including

IT-BPM, BFSI, Telecom, industry associations, data protection authorities and think-tanks for

public advocacy, thought leadership, capacity building and outreach initiatives.

To further its objectives, DSCI engages with governments, regulators, industry associations

and think-tanks on policy matters. To strengthen thought leadership in cyber security and

privacy, DSCI develops best practices and frameworks, publishes studies, surveys and papers.

It builds capacity in security, privacy and cyber forensics through training and certifi cation

program for professionals and law enforcement agencies and engages stakeholders through

various outreach initiatives including events, awards, chapters, consultations and membership

programs. DSCI also endeavors to increase India’s share in the global security product and

services market through global trade development initiatives. These aim to strengthen the

security and privacy culture in the India.

Thought Leadership

Development of Best Practices, Frameworks, Standards and Assessment

DSCI Security Framework (DSF©) is a best practices document that promotes dynamism •

in data security within organizations

DSCI Privacy Framework (DPF©) is a best practices document to help build organizational •

competence in privacy protection

DSCI Assessment Framework (DAF©)•

DSCI Assessment Framework – Security ( DAF-S©) it is assessing maturity in different »disciplines of security of an organization

DSCI Assessment Framework – Privacy ( DAF-P©) it is assessing maturity of different »aspects of privacy implementation and initiatives of an organization

DSCI Privacy Ecosystem Development

It is a comprehensive privacy program based on a well-defi ned privacy policy•

Privacy program implementation across the organization, with appropriate monitoring & •

oversight mechanisms to check non-compliances and performance

Provides framework for designing and implementing

such a privacy program in an organization

Designed to assess organization’s privacy initiatives

which can be used by external or internal assessors to

certify successful implementation

The Certifi cation scheme for organization is based on •

the independent third-party privacy assessments carried

out by DSCI-authorized Assessment Organizations

(AOs) based on DAF-P© & DPF©

It aims to help organizations demonstrate implementation •

of a sound privacy program,enhance trust and provide

assurance to data subjects, regulators and clients

DSCI Certifi cations Program

Certifi ed Cyber Forensics Professional

– India CCFP-In is intended for digital

forensics managers, consultants &

investigators

Launched in 2014 in collaboration »with (ISC)2

Localized the CCFP-In for India to »meet specifi c needs of the Indian

forensics community.

For Individuals

DSCI Certifi ed Privacy Lead Assessor

(DCPLA©) is intended for privacy

assessors, implementers & managers

Three-day program (Classroom »training & examination)

DSCI Certifi ed Privacy Professionals

(DCPP©)is intended for aspiring privacy

professionals

Preparation based on Privacy »Body of Knowledge (PBoK)

& examination
